Basic measurement concepts are fundamental skills in early education that significantly impact a child's cognitive development and everyday life. For parents and teachers, understanding these concepts fosters a child's ability to make comparisons and understand quantities, which are critical for problem-solving and critical thinking. Early exposure to measurement helps children strengthen their number sense by using terms like length, width, height, and volume, which they encounter in daily activities, such as cooking and shopping.
Additionally, measurement concepts integrate various subjects, including science, art, and geography, enhancing a child's exploration and understanding of the world. Whether through measuring ingredients in a recipe, estimating distances for a trip, or drawing shapes in art class, these skills are employed in versatile contexts.
Furthermore, these concepts equip children to handle future mathematical challenges with confidence. By promoting early measurement skills, parents and teachers create a solid foundation for lifelong learning, ensuring that children develop the necessary proficiencies for advanced math courses. Ultimately, focusing on basic measurement lays the groundwork for success in academia and personal life, making it essential for caregivers to prioritize this area in early education.
